9th Feb James Findlay

 

Winner of the BBC Young Folk Award in 2010

Not just a fiddler, not just a guitarist, but a wonderful singer too! James has a family background of traditional music and song, and displays an extensive range of material, and a knowledge and love of the songs, particularly those from his West Country.

James has two highly acclaimed albums out with Fellside: ?Sport and Play' and ?Another Day Another Story.'  Sport and Play was in MOJO's list of top ten folk albums of 2013 and Another Day Another Story was nominated for ?Best Folk Album 2013? in the Spiral Earth Awards. 

James has recently been involved in some high profile projects. These include the recording of songs from 'The New Penguin Book of English Folk Songs' with Lucy Ward, Bella Hardy and Brian Peters;

"Bloody hell, what a voice! This was my first thought as he launched into his songs. He's warmly charismatic with that sparkle of personality that draws a crowd along with him." 

- JON BODEN (Bellowhead)

23rd Feb Tim Laycock & Colin Thompson

 

2 outstanding founder members of the New Scorpion Band present songs, tunes and a few readings with the emphasis on their native Dorset. Tim on melodeon, concertina and vocals and 

Colin on Fiddle (author of The English Fiddle Tutor).
